I am grateful to have gone through the experience of losing people close to me suddenly. Why? These experiences, while sad, taught me to truly appreciate the limited time I have with friends and love ones. These experiences also caused me to ask myself the important question of how I wanted to spend my limited time here, how do I want to contribute to the world, what kind of legacy do I wish to have. I am also much more careful with what I say to others now, they may be here now but they might not be here come sundown, I now ask “do I really want to leave off on that note?”

I am grateful that I have a clean bill of health. So many take this for-granted, your fine one day and then suddenly your not. If I wake up with all my limbs and not sick, my day has already begun on a positive note. I appreciate my state of health, and I spend so much time at the gym to maintain or improve my state, and because I can, and because I can I will take full advantage of being able to, while I still can.

I am grateful for the various communities I am apart of. Without them, where would I be today? I truly appreciate the sense of kinship, and closeness that comes from interacting with others. I love being exposed to new and diverse points of view on a daily basis. I am also grateful that I am able to do these same things, and more for others, through my participation.

I am grateful that I can forgive others easily. Trying to fight every battle, pay back every slight no matter how minor, allowing myself to be consumed by a need for revenge, constantly thinking negatively and causing negativity to manifest in the world through my actions, allowing others to have so much power over me, what way is that to live? I forgive, but do not forget. But just because someone does something once, doesn’t mean they will do it again, one should be vigilant, but not allow the past to bias them.

I am grateful for all the pain and struggle I have gone through so far in life, and I wouldn’t change a thing. Without it, would I be the person I am today? Would I have reflected on my actions so much? Would I have done so much internal work? Would I have learned as much as I have?

No, I wouldn’t have, or it would have taken much, much longer to get where I am today. Through pain and struggle comes strength and wisdom, the ability to remain keep going in the face of odds that appear to be insurmountable, and so much more.

I am grateful for these things mainly, and so much more. If I wrote a list of all the things I am grateful for, I would be writing it for weeks.

I feel it is important to seek balance. If you rant, you should look to what you are grateful for. This is a practice I seek to keep up at my own little cave. If I vent and complain, I need to also highlight something I am grateful for. Helping to change from focusing on the problem to focusing on the solution. In this case it is an easy thing to do.

What I am grateful for is the Jedi here. I don't know if there is a need to add to that statement. We all face tough situations in life. We all find ourselves challenged on the path. But one of the great benefits of a worldwide community is being able to talk with other like-minded individuals. To have other Jedi in your life who uplift and encourage. So I am definitely grateful for the Jedi in our community.
